  • Page 10: Flight Steps

    Flight Steps 1. Frequency Pairing When the drone is turned on, the light on the fuselage will flash rapidly. When the light flashes slowly, it indicates that frequency pairing is entered. It must be placed on a surface! Turn on the remote control, the power indicator lights up and flashes rapidly.
  • Page 11: Emergency Landing

    2. Take Off After a successful calibration, press this button and the drone will automatically take off and remain at an altitude of approximately 1.2 meters. 3. Landing Press this button to land the drone automatically. (When pressing this button, do not touch the left joystick, otherwise it may not work).

  • Page 15: Stunt Flying

    8. Stunt Flying Rotation Mode: Short press the rotation button to start / quit the rotation mode, the remote control will beep at this time. Rotation Button Circle Fly Mode: Short press the circle button to start / quit circle fly mode, then the remote control will beep.
  • Page 16 9. 3D Flip Step 1: Short press the left joystick to start the flip mode, at this time the remote control emits a continuous "beep" sound. Step 2: Push the right joystick forward and the drone will immediately flip forward 360°. Tips: If you want to flip in another direction, push the right joystick to another direction.
  • Page 17 Forward and Backward Fine-tuning While in flight, if the drone tilts forward, press down the fine-tuning button, and push the right joystick backwards. Otherwise push forwards. Left / Right Rotates Fine-tuning While in flight, if the drone head rotates to the left, press the fine-tuning button, and push left joystick to right.
  • Page 18: Functions Mode

    Functions Mode 1. Altitude Hold Mode Intelligent flight control system calculates the hovering position, makes it easier for beginners to control. Note: If there’s propeller or motor is damaged, the constant height function will not work. The altitude hold function will also not work due to unstable atmospheric pressure or unsuitable weather.
  • Page 19 3. Headless Mode The default setting is Non-headless Mode Under headless mode, the users can operate the drone without worrying about the orientation (left is left and right is right all the time, regardless of where your drone is pointing at).
  • Page 20: Low Battery Alarm

    * Press headless mode button to activate the function, then the LED light at the rear of the drone will keep flashing 3 times and stop for 1 second. To exit the Headless Mode, press the button again, at this time the LED light on the rear of drone will turn to solid color.
